As a parent or educator, I've found that using outdoor STEM challenge cards truly transforms summer learning into an exciting adventure. These cards offer projects like building leaf boats, creating bug shelters, nature camouflage tests, and constructing the tallest nature towers—all using natural materials such as sticks, leaves, bark, and grass. Not only do these activities engage children’s scientific curiosity, but they also foster essential skills like problem-solving and teamwork. One of my favorite challenges is designing a leaf boat and then testing how well it floats. It prompts kids to think critically about shapes and materials that help their boat stay balanced in water, encouraging trial and error and thoughtful reflection. The included STEM journals add great value, guiding kids through planning, observation, reflection, and analysis phases, which mimic real scientific inquiry. Another rewarding experience is the nature camouflage challenge, where kids find natural objects that blend in with their surroundings and then try to hide their own creations. This opens conversations about biological adaptation and the importance of camouflage for animals. These outdoor activities not only enrich children's knowledge of science and engineering but also support social-emotional development—such as building resilience and communication—as children collaborate on creative solutions. Plus, they offer a fantastic break from screens, promoting physical movement and interaction with nature.
